Corsair ValueSelect DDR2-667 2GB SODIMMs


Corsair, a worldwide leader in high performance computer products, today unveiled production-ready 2GB DDR2-667 (PC5300) ValueSelectTM SODIMMs. Designed for current generation notebooks and mini-PCs, the new high density SODIMMs allow users to maximize memory bandwidth and minimize performance bottleneck to deliver superior user experience. The Corsair ValueSelect SODIMMs are optimized for Microsoft Windows VistaTM client operating system.

Current notebooks typically support up to 4GB of system memory when using a 64-bit operating system but feature only two memory slots. With this limitation in mind, it means users have to use 2GB SODIMM modules in order to maximize memory capacity. Having more memory in the notebook is vital in delivering a faster system response time and a smoother user experience, said Richard Hashim, Director of Product Marketing at Corsair. For those looking to transition to Vista, the 2GB modules allows instant upgrade of current notebooks to be Vista Ready and delivers Vista premium experiences.

The new ValueSelect 2GB SODIMMs are designed to meet the growing demand for high density SODIMMs for maximum system responsiveness. Individually tested and certified to run at 667MHz, the new SODIMM is compatible with current Intel� CentrinoTM Duo based notebooks.


Corsair ValueSelect DDR2-667 2GB SODIMM Features:

- Individually tested at 1.8v
- Up to 50% less power consumption
- Superior hardware design to reduce heat generation
- Corsair part number: VS2GSDS667D2
- Lifetime warranty

The Corsair ValueSelect 2GB SODIMM memory modules are immediately available through Corsair�s worldwide authorized distributors, retailers, resellers and e-tailers. The introductory MSRP is $489 USD.

Corsair DDR2-667 SODIMM For Mac



Corsair, a worldwide leader in high performance computer products, today launched Mac Memory, their first memory DDR2-667 SODIMM products to support Apple PCs. Three products were announced today, the 1GB upgrade module, the 2GB upgrade kit (two 1GB modules) and the 3GB upgrade kit (one 1GB module and one 2GB module). The 1GB upgrade module and 2GB upgrade kit are compatible with the MacBook family, MacBook Pro family, and Intel-based versions of the iMac. The 3GB upgrade kit is compatible only with the MacBook Pro family and those models of iMac's supporting up to 3GB of system memory.

Apple's hardware and software products are making it simple for users to create and edit their digital memories, such as their home videos and photo albums. "Hence, users need all the performance they can squeeze out of their systems to create those items fast," said Richard Hashim, Director of Product Marketing at Corsair.� �Adding system memory is a really effective way to improve performance. Corsair's Mac Memory product family is the choice for upgrading the MacBook, the MacBook Pro and the iMac family of products.

The Mac Memory SODIMMs allow users to maximize memory bandwidth and minimize performance bottlenecks to deliver a superior user experience. Built to Corsair's legendary quality and reliability standards, each module is tested to ensure maximum compatibility. Each Mac Memory module is individually tested and certified to run at 667MHz and be compatible with Apple products.

Mac Memory Product Features/Specifications:

* DDR2-667 SODIMMs
* 1GB upgrade module and 2GB upgrade kit are compatible with the MacBook, the MacBook Pro, and Intel-based versions of the iMac
* 3GB upgrade kit is compatible with the MacBook Pro, and the models of the iMac supporting 3GB of system memory
* Lifetime warranty

Corsair Mac Memory products are available immediately through Corsair's authorized distributors, resellers, retailers and e-tailers. The introductory MSRP for the 1GB upgrade module, 2GB upgrade kit, and the 3GB upgrade kit are $119.99, $239.99, and $679.99 respectively. Corsair Mac Memory products are backed by a lifetime warranty and complete customer support via telephone, email, forum and TechSupport Xpress troubleshooting guide.
